Air Jacketed CO2 Incubator NACI-600

Air Jacketed CO2 Incubator NACI-600 features a 40L capacity, providing ample space for cell cultures. This incubator ensures stable internal conditions, using an air-jacketed heating system. It maintains consistent CO₂ levels with an advanced infrared sensor, delivering reliable performance. It offers fast recovery after door openings, protecting sample integrity. Our unit maintains high humidity through natural vaporization, supporting optimal chamber conditions.

Specifications

Volume 40L
Temperature Range RT+5 to 55℃
Ambient Temperature +5 to 30℃
Temperature Stability ±0.1℃
CO2 Range 0 to 20% V/V
CO2 Control Resolution ±0.1%(IR sensor)
CO2 Recovery (Door open 30s,recovery to 5%) ≤ 3min
Temperature Recovery (Door open 30s,recovery to 37℃ ) ≤ 8min
Humidity Method Natural vaporization≥90%
Heating Method Air-jacketed, PID Control
Sterilization method 90°C moist heat disinfection (18hrs)+UV Sterilizer
Screen 7 inch Touch screen
Shelves 2
Power Consumption 350W
Voltage 220V 50Hz
Internal Dimension (L×W×H) 286×400×350 mm
External Dimension (L×W×H) 440×590×576 mm
Gross Weight 70 kg

Features

  • User-friendly interface
  • Touch-screen controller with data logging
  • High-efficiency microorganism filter
  • Anti-condensation glass door design
  • Intelligent fan speed control

Applications

  • Air Jacketed CO2 Incubator NACI-600 is used to maintain cell cultures in a controlled environment. It is applied in fields such as biomedical research, cell biology, pharmaceuticals, and clinical laboratories.
